Actaully it will probably work as good as any other CAI out there. The stock air box is a restirction, and if you look in a stock elbow it strinks way down between the ABS module and Rad. shroud.
The name brands once have a plate to seal the air filter out of the hot engine bay, but that can be from a sheet of tin and a few screws.
Plus for $50 it will look nicer then Home Depo ones built out of PVC.
